A Drupal 11 site for Riverside Physical Therapy. Nearly all frontend work lives in a single custom module (`riverside_pt`) rather than a Drupal theme. The site runs in Docker with nginx + php-fpm + PostgreSQL.
By default, **every**`docker compose up` performs a full database wipe followed by a complete reinstall + rebuild of the site structure from code:
- Drops the database
- Runs `drush site:install standard`
- Enables modules (including `riverside_pt`)
- Runs `drush riverside:rebuild` (the single source of truth for content types, fields, roles, and navigation)
This means the site is **always** built exactly the same way from the code in `riverside_pt.install` and the Drush command. There is no persistent data between restarts unless you opt out.
**Faster iteration (preserve the database):**
```bash
DRUPAL_FAST=1 docker compose up
```
This skips the wipe + `site:install` but still runs `drush riverside:rebuild` and the rest of the startup steps. Use this when you want quicker starts during active development and don't need a completely clean slate.

The custom module directory is volume-mounted, so template/CSS/JS edits are live without rebuilding the Docker image. `settings.php` and `development.services.yml` are also volume-mounted.
**Known gotcha:** `drush site:install` rewrites `settings.php`. Because `settings.php` is a bind-mounted file, Docker Desktop on macOS may hold a stale inode reference after the rewrite. If Drupal shows "The provided host name is not valid for this server" after a full rebuild, restart with `DRUPAL_FAST=1` to re-establish the mount without re-running site:install.

`web/sites/development.services.yml` is loaded when `DEBUG=true` (set in docker-compose). It enables Twig debug/auto-reload and defines `cache.backend.null` (used by `settings.php` to disable render/page caching in dev).
## Menu / navigation
Nav items come from Drupal's `main` menu. Items titled `"Book An Appointment"` or `"Contact"` are flagged `is_cta: true` in the preprocess hook and rendered as a CTA button in the header template.
Booking confirmation emails are sent via `riverside_pt_mail()` in `.module` using the `booking_request` key. Transport is Postmark (via `drupal/symfony_mailer`), configured in `config/sync/symfony_mailer.mailer_transport.postmark.yml`. The API key is injected via the `POSTMARK_API_KEY` environment variable.
- If `DEBUG` (dev/localhost): force `system.mail.interface.default = 'php_mail'` (so it uses the mocked sendmail_path below) and never use Postmark.
- Else if `POSTMARK_API_KEY` present (prod): set `mailer_transport.settings.default_transport = postmark` and `system.mail.interface.default = symfony_mailer`.
On localhost/dev (when `DEBUG` is truthy), a fake sendmail binary is provided (via Dockerfile + entrypoint) **only in DEBUG mode** that prints the full email to stderr (visible via `docker compose logs`) instead of failing with "sh: 1: /usr/sbin/sendmail: not found". This catches any legacy `php_mail` fallbacks. Real transactional mail goes through Postmark when configured (non-DEBUG).
